1960: M10
The BMW M10 engine, an inline-four designed by Baron Alex von Falkenhausen, was produced from 1962 to 1988. This legendary engine powered many iconic BMWs, known for its durable cast-iron block and adaptable aluminum cross-flow cylinder head.
- Configuration: Inline-4
- Block Material: Cast Iron
- Head Material: Aluminum
- Valvetrain: Single Overhead Cam (SOHC) with two valves per cylinder, chain-driven camshaft
- Crankshaft: Forged steel
- Connecting Rods: Forged steel
- Piston Material: Aluminum alloy (cast for standard, forged for higher performance/turbo)
M115
- Displacement: 1,499 cc (91.5 cu in)
- Bore x Stroke: 82 mm (3.2 in) x 71 mm (2.8 in)
- Power Output: 55–59 kW (75–82 PS; 74–80 hp), 118 N⋅m (87 lb⋅ft)
at 3700 rpm - Compression Ratio: 8.0:1 – 8.8:1
- Fuel System: Solex 38 PDSI carburetor
- Applications: 1962-1964 BMW 1500, 1975-1977 BMW 1502
M116
- Displacement: 1,573 cc (96.0 cu in)
- Bore x Stroke: 84 mm (3.3 in) x 71 mm (2.8 in)
M116 (Standard):
- Power Output: 63 kW (86 PS; 84 hp), 130 N⋅m (96 lb⋅ft)
at 3500 rpm - Compression Ratio: 8.6:1
- Fuel System: Solex 38 PDSI carburetor
- Applications: 1964-1966 BMW 1600, 1966-1975 BMW 1600-2/1602
M116 (1600 ti):
- Power Output: 77 kW (105 PS; 103 hp), 141 N⋅m (104 lb⋅ft)
at 4500 rpm - Compression Ratio: 9.5:1
- Fuel System: Twin Solex 40 PHH carburetors
- Applications: 1967-1968 BMW 1600 ti
M41
- Displacement: 1,573 cc (96.0 cu in)
- Bore x Stroke: 84 mm (3.3 in) x 71 mm (2.8 in)
- Power Output: 66 kW (90 PS; 89 hp), 167 N⋅m (123 lb⋅ft)
at 4000 rpm - Compression Ratio: 8.3:1
- Fuel System: Solex 32 DIDTA carburetor
- Applications: 1975-1980 E21 316
M98
- Displacement: 1,573 cc (96.0 cu in)
- Bore x Stroke: 84 mm (3.3 in) x 71 mm (2.8 in)
- Power Output: 55 kW (75 PS; 74 hp), 110 N⋅m (81 lb⋅ft)
at 3200 rpm - Compression Ratio: 9.5:1
- Fuel System: Pierburg 1B2 carburetor
- Applications: 1981-1983 E21 315
M10B18
- Displacement: 1,766 cc (107.8 cu in)
- Bore x Stroke: 89 mm (3.5 in) x 71 mm (2.8 in)
- Power Output: 66–77 kW (90–105 PS; 89–104 hp), 135 N⋅m-145 N⋅m (100-107 lb⋅ft)
at 3500-4500 rpm depending on spec. - Compression Ratio: 8.6:1 – 10.0:1
- Fuel System: Solex 36-40 PDSI carburetor, Solex 38 PDSI carburetor, Bosch K-Jetronic mechanical fuel injection, Bosch L-Jetronic electronic fuel injection, Pierburg 2BE carburetor
- Applications: 1969-1972 1800, 1971-1975 1802, 1980-1983 E21 320i/320is (US only), 1980-1983 E12 518 (South Africa only), 1982-1987 E30 316, 1982-1988 E30 318i, 1981-1988 E28 518i
M118
- Displacement: 1,773 cc (108.2 cu in)
- Bore x Stroke: 84 mm (3.3 in) x 80 mm (3.1 in)
- Power Output: 66–96 kW (90–130 PS; 89–128 hp), 144 N⋅m-157 N⋅m (106-116 lb⋅ft)
at 3000-5100 rpm depending on spec. - Compression Ratio: 8.6:1 – 10.5:1
- Fuel System: Solex 36-40 PDSI carburetor, twin Solex 40 PHH carburetors, twin Weber DCOE-45 carburetors
- Applications: 1963-1968 1800, 1963-1966 1800ti, 1964-1965 1800tiSA, 1974-1981 E12 518
M05
- Displacement: 1,990 cc (121.4 cu in)
- Bore x Stroke: 89 mm (3.5 in) x 80 mm (3.1 in)
- Power Output: 74–88 kW (100–120 PS; 99–118 hp)
- Torque: 157–167 N⋅m (116–123 lb⋅ft)
- Compression Ratio: 8.5:1 – 9.3:1
- Fuel System: Solex 40 PDSI carburetor or Solex 40 PHH carburetors
- Applications: 1965–1970 BMW 2000CS, 1966–1970 BMW 2000C, 1966–1972 BMW 2000, 1966–1971 BMW 2000ti, 1968–1976 BMW 2002, 1968–1971 BMW 2002ti
M17
- Displacement: 1,990 cc (121.4 cu in)
- Bore x Stroke: 89 mm (3.5 in) x 80 mm (3.1 in)
- Power Output: 85 kW (115 PS; 113 hp) at 5,800 rpm
- Torque: 165 N⋅m (122 lb⋅ft) at 3,700 rpm
- Compression Ratio: 9.0:1
- Fuel System: Twin Stromberg 175 CDET carburetors
- Applications: 1972–1977 BMW E12 520
M15
- Displacement: 1,990 cc (121.4 cu in)
- Bore x Stroke: 89 mm (3.5 in) x 80 mm (3.1 in)
- Power Output: 96 kW (130 PS; 128 hp) at 5,800 rpm
- Torque: 177 N⋅m (131 lb⋅ft) at 4,500 rpm
- Compression Ratio: 9.3:1 – 10.0:1
- Fuel System: Kugelfischer Mechanical Fuel Injection (MFI)
- Applications: 1970–1973 BMW 2000tii, 1971–1975 BMW 2002tii, 1972–1974 BMW E12 520i (early models)
M43
- Displacement: 1,990 cc (121.4 cu in)
- Bore x Stroke: 89 mm (3.5 in) x 80 mm (3.1 in)
- Power Output: 80 kW (109 PS; 107 hp) at 5,800 rpm
- Torque: 157 N⋅m (116 lb⋅ft) at 3,700 rpm
- Compression Ratio: 8.1:1
- Fuel System: Solex 32-32 DIDTA carburetor
- Applications: 1975–1979 BMW E21 320 (carbureted version)
M64
- Displacement: 1,990 cc (121.4 cu in)
- Bore x Stroke: 89 mm (3.5 in) x 80 mm (3.1 in)
- Power Output: 92 kW (125 PS; 123 hp) at 5,700 rpm
- Torque: 172 N⋅m (127 lb⋅ft) at 4,350 rpm
- Compression Ratio: 9.3:1
- Fuel System: Bosch K-Jetronic Mechanical Fuel Injection
- Applications: 1975–1979 BMW E21 320i, 1975–1979 BMW E12 520i
M31
- Displacement: 1,990 cc (121.4 cu in)
- Bore x Stroke: 89 mm (3.5 in) x 80 mm (3.1 in)
- Power Output: 125 kW (170 PS; 168 hp) at 5,800 rpm
- Torque: 245 N⋅m (181 lb⋅ft) at 4,000 rpm
- Compression Ratio: 6.9:1
- Fuel System: Schafer PL 04 Mechanical Fuel Injection (with KKK BLD Turbocharger)
- Applications: 1973–1975 BMW 2002 turbo
1971: M30
The BMW M30, or “Big Six,” was an iconic inline-six engine produced from 1968-1995. Renowned for its robustness, smooth power, and strong torque, this durable engine powered a wide range of BMWs, cementing its legacy as a true workhorse.
- Configuration: Inline-6
- Block Material: Cast Iron
- Head Material: Aluminum
- Valvetrain: Single Overhead Cam (SOHC) with two valves per cylinder, chain-driven camshaft
- Crankshaft: Forged steel
- Connecting Rods: Forged steel
- Piston Material: Aluminum alloy (typically cast for standard, forged for higher performance/turbo variants or aftermarket)
M30B25V
- Displacement: 2,494 cc (152.2 cu in)
- Bore x Stroke: 86.0 mm (3.39 in) x 71.6 mm (2.82 in)
- Power Output: 110 kW (150 PS; 148 hp) at 6,000 rpm
- Torque: 211 N⋅m (156 lb⋅ft) at 3,700 rpm
- Compression Ratio: 9.0:1
- Fuel System: Dual Solex Zenith 35/40 INAT Carburetors
- Applications: 1968–1977 BMW E3 2500, 1974–1975 BMW E9 2.5 CS, 1973–1976 BMW E12 525, 1976–1981 BMW E12 525, 1977–1979 BMW E23 725
M30B25
- Displacement: 2,494 cc (152.2 cu in)
- Bore x Stroke: 86.0 mm (3.39 in) x 71.6 mm (2.82 in)
- Power Output: 110 kW (150 PS; 148 hp) at 5,800 rpm
- Torque: 215 N⋅m (159 lb⋅ft) at 4,000 rpm
- Compression Ratio: 9.6:1
- Fuel System: Bosch L-Jetronic (Electronic Fuel Injection)
- Applications: 1981–1987 BMW E28 525i, 1981–1986 BMW E23 725i
M30B28V
- Displacement: 2,788 cc (170.1 cu in)
- Bore x Stroke: 86.0 mm (3.39 in) x 80.0 mm (3.15 in)
- Power Output: 125 kW (170 PS; 168 hp) at 5,800 rpm
- Torque: 235 N⋅m (173 lb⋅ft) at 3,700 rpm
- Compression Ratio: 9.0:1
- Fuel System: Dual Zenith 35/40 INAT Carburetors
- Applications: 1968–1977 BMW E3 2800 / 2800 L, 1968–1971 BMW E9 2800 CS, 1972–1976 BMW E12 528
M30B28
- Displacement: 2,788 cc (170.1 cu in)
- Bore x Stroke: 86.0 mm (3.39 in) x 80.0 mm (3.15 in)
- Power Output: 135 kW (184 PS; 181 hp) at 5,800 rpm
- Torque: 240 N⋅m (177 lb⋅ft) at 4,200 rpm
- Compression Ratio: 9.3:1
- Fuel System: Bosch L-Jetronic (Electronic Fuel Injection)
- Applications: 1977–1981 BMW E12 528i, 1979–1986 BMW E28 528i, 1979–1986 BMW E23 728i, 1979–1987 BMW E24 628CSi
M30B30V
- Displacement: 2,986 cc (182.2 cu in)
- Bore x Stroke: 89.0 mm (3.50 in) x 80.0 mm (3.15 in)
- Power Output: 132 kW (180 PS; 178 hp) at 6,000 rpm
- Torque: 255 N⋅m (188 lb⋅ft) at 3,700 rpm
- Compression Ratio: 9.0:1
- Fuel System: Dual Zenith 35/40 INAT Carburetors
- Applications: 1971–1975 BMW E9 3.0 CS, 1971–1977 BMW E3 3.0 S / L / Bavaria, 1976–1979 BMW E24 630 CS, 1977–1979 BMW E23 730
M30B30
- Displacement: 2,986 cc (182.2 cu in)
- Bore x Stroke: 89.0 mm (3.50 in) x 80.0 mm (3.15 in)
- Power Output: 147 kW (200 PS; 197 hp) at 5,500 rpm
- Torque: 272 N⋅m (201 lb⋅ft) at 4,300 rpm
- Compression Ratio: 9.2:1
- Fuel System: Bosch D-Jetronic / L-Jetronic (Electronic Fuel Injection)
- Applications: 1971–1975 BMW E9 3.0 CSi, 1978–1979 BMW E23 730i (European Market), 1986-1995 E32 730i — 138 kW (185 bhp), 1988-1990 E34 530i — 138 kW (185 bhp
M30B32
- Displacement: 3,210 cc (195.9 cu in)
- Bore x Stroke: 89.0 mm (3.50 in) x 86.0 mm (3.39 in)
- Power Output: 145 kW (197 PS; 194 hp) at 5,500 rpm
- Torque: 280 N⋅m (207 lb⋅ft) at 4,300 rpm
- Compression Ratio: 9.6:1
- Fuel System: Bosch L-Jetronic / Motronic (Electronic Fuel Injection)
- Applications: 1976–1984 BMW E24 633CSi, 1977–1983 BMW E23 732i, 1985-1988 E28 535i / 535is / M535i
M30B33V
- Displacement: 3,295 cc (201.1 cu in)
- Bore x Stroke: 89.0 mm (3.50 in) x 88.0 mm (3.46 in)
- Power Output: 139 kW (189 PS; 186 hp) at 5,500 rpm
- Torque: 289 N⋅m (213 lb⋅ft) at 3,500 rpm
- Compression Ratio: 9.0:1
- Fuel System: Dual Zenith 35/40 INAT Carburetors
- Applications: 1973–1975 BMW E3 3.3 L (Long Wheelbase Sedan)
M30B34
- Displacement: 3,430 cc (209.3 cu in)
- Bore x Stroke: 92.0 mm (3.62 in) x 86.0 mm (3.39 in)
- Power Output: 160 kW (218 PS; 215 hp) at 5,500 rpm
- Torque: 310 N⋅m (229 lb⋅ft) at 4,000 rpm
- Compression Ratio: 10.0:1
- Fuel System: Bosch Motronic (Digital Motor Electronics)
- Applications: 1982–1987 BMW E28 535i / M535i, 1982–1987 BMW E24 635CSi, 1982–1987 BMW E23 735i
M30B35
- Displacement: 3,430 cc (209.3 cu in)
- Bore x Stroke: 92 mm (3.62 in) x 86 mm (3.39 in)
- Power Output: 163 kW (221 PS; 218 hp) at 5,400 rpm
- Torque: 305 N⋅m (225 lb⋅ft) at 4,000 rpm
- Compression Ratio: 10.0:1
- Fuel System: Bosch Motronic (Digital Motor Electronics)
- Applications: 1988–1992 BMW E34 535i, 1988–1992 BMW E32 735i/iL
